Prime Minister Keir Starmer is expected to announce a support package for UK households facing increased energy bills, particularly heating oil users, as a result of the ongoing conflict involving Iran.

Rising energy costs have placed financial pressure on many UK households, especially those relying on heating oil. The government's response aims to address affordability concerns and provide relief during a period of international instability affecting energy markets.

Details of the support plan are expected to be outlined at a Downing Street press conference. Observers will watch for specifics on eligibility, the scale of assistance, and any further measures to address energy price volatility.
